A selective estrogen receptor modulator designed for the treatment of uterine leiomyoma with unique tissue specificity for uterus and ovaries in rats

The design of a novel selective estrogen receptor modulator (SERM) for the potential treatment of uterine leiomyoma is described. 16 (LY2066948-HCl) binds with high affinity to estrogen receptors α and β (ERα and ERβ, respectively) and is a potent uterine
